Chest Pain Due To Bronchitis. Bronchitis is when the airways leading to your lungs (trachea and bronchi) get inflamed and fill with mucus. Signs and symptoms include cough, mucus, fatigue and chest discomfort. Symptoms include coughing, mucus production, chest pain, fatigue,. Bronchitis is a condition in which the airways in the lower respiratory system become inflamed. You don't need antibiotics, but bed rest and home care can help. Chest pain, soreness, and tightness in the chest. Acute bronchitis causes coughs that produce mucus.
